Worcester has six school districts serving over 26,500 students across 60 schools, and Varsity Tutors connects students with tutors who understand the different curricula and standards across these districts. Whether your student attends a Worcester Public Schools campus, a charter school, or a private institution, we can match them with a tutor familiar with their specific academic environment and local expectations.
Massachusetts has rigorous state standards, particularly in math and English language arts, and personalized 1-on-1 instruction is proven to help students master these benchmarks more effectively than classroom instruction alone. Tutors working with Worcester students focus on the specific competencies required by Massachusetts frameworks, including MCAS preparation, writing standards, and problem-solving skills that align with state expectations.
Worcester students typically seek help with math (including algebra and geometry), English language arts, test preparation for MCAS and standardized tests, and science. With Worcester's 15.1:1 average student-teacher ratio, many students benefit from the focused attention that personalized tutoring provides to fill gaps and accelerate learning in these core subjects.
